The equation of the parent graph is y = x^2.
To translate it 3 units down, we subtract 3 from y: y = x^2 - 3.
To translate it 6 units to the right, we subtract 6 from x: y = (x-6)^2.
Therefore, the equation of the translated graph is y = (x-6)^2 - 3.
